我有一个HTML网站,example.html
。我想按小时计划它的开放,所以我写了一个.bat文件,execute.bat
,我想安排在默认浏览器中打开
@echo Off
start C:\example.html
执行(双击)execute.bat
打开网站没有问题。但是,当我安排它时,它没有执行:在任务管理器中,我看到浏览器正在做某事但我看不到它的GUI与网站开放。
我尝试通过bat文件进行调度(在启动程序字段时给出C:\execute.bat
目录),我确实尝试将cmd作为使用/c start "" "C:\execute.bat"
的可选参数运行的程序,我也尝试指定浏览器的执行。 exe目录在bat文件中运行html。这些尝试不起作用。
在Windows调度程序中安排打开HTML文件时是否有任何特殊需要注意?
我正在使用Windows Server 2012
如果您不勾选仅在用户登录时运行,则它在您无权访问的桌面上运行,因此它是不可见的。
这将每小时运行一个文件名example.html。文件example.html与.bat文件所在的目录相同
:loop
C:\example.html
timeout /t 3600 /nobreak
goto :loop